Taste tripping on miracle fruit

Last May there was an article on the Miracle Fruit in the NYT. This fruit blocks your sour taste buds making sour things taste sweet. You can purchase Miracle Fruit tablets on thinkgeek.

So back to why 11 people (+2 virtual ones) were in my apartment... we had a taste tripping party. Basically what happens is you let a tablet dissolve in your mouth and then eat a weird combination of foods. Here's what we tried:
  • Lemons, limes - by far the best, however this time around I paced myself so afterward I didn't feel like a ate a bunch of citrus.
  • Vinegar - go ahead, drink a cap-full! [Note, J disagrees with me on this, when he'd tried vinegar he thought it just tasted like vinegar.]
  • Pickles - interesting.
  • Yellow mustard - eh, but thanks SB for squirting half the bottle into my mouth! :)
  • Tobasco - ummm, still tastes like Tobasco. Check what you write in your articles NYT!
  • Goat cheese - tastes a little less sour, but NOT like cheesecake.
  • Sour apples - ok, nothing crazy.
  • 'Sour patch kids' - meh, just tastes like sweet candy. Not worth it.
It's a fun experience, especially with a bunch of friends. Feels like you should be tripping, but you're totally sober.
